Keston teams up with Royal Oak

A Surrey pub is teaming up with Keston Gun Club for its annual 50-bird charity shoot on 21 September.

Shoot Poster

The Royal Oak in Tandridge set up its own charity fund 11 years ago and has since raised £50,000 for the local community. As part of the registered charity (number 1085009), it teams up with Keston Gun Club each year for a charity shoot.

There will be a BBQ on site as well as a charity shoot and tuition for beginners, but the 50-bird competition is nothing to be sniffed at. The Royal Oak Charity Fund’s Judy Whittaker said: “It’s always fund and challenges even the most experienced shots, but we have tuition on site and everyone is welcome.”
